Understanding the Common Causes of Wireless Mouse Freezing

Signal Interference Issues

Sometimes the problem is not with your mouse at all, but with the environment in which it is used. Nearby devices such as Wi-Fi routers, cordless phones, and even metal objects can cause signal disruptions. Easy adjustments, like moving clutter away from your workspace, can help reduce these issues.

Battery-Related Problems

A weak or depleted battery can lead to intermittent connectivity and lag. It is important to check your battery health on a regular basis and replace charged batteries with high-quality ones. This ensures that your mouse maintains a reliable connection.

Driver and Software Conflicts

Outdated, corrupted, or incompatible drivers are common causes of mouse stuttering and freezing. Recent system updates or new installations can sometimes lead to conflicts. Keeping your drivers updated and checking for any software conflicts can save you time and frustration.

Checklist for Diagnosing Wireless Mouse Freezing Issues

Check Physical Connections

Begin by ensuring that the USB receiver is securely connected. Try a different USB port to confirm that the issue is not related to a faulty port. A stable connection is the first step to a smoother mouse performance.

Inspect Battery Health

Replace or recharge your mouse batteries as needed. Using high-quality batteries will help prevent those frustrating intermittent connection problems. Regular maintenance of battery health can make a big difference.

Identify Signal Interference

Try moving the mouse's receiver closer to the device. Removing or reducing nearby electronic interference enhances the signal strength between the mouse and its receiver, promoting smoother operation.

Fix Wireless Mouse Freezing with Simple Troubleshooting

Update or Reinstall Drivers

Head over to your Device Manager and look for any available driver updates. If updating does not solve the issue, consider uninstalling then reinstalling the mouse drivers. This can often resolve conflicts that may have developed over time.

Adjust Mouse and System Settings

Disabling pointer trails and enhancing pointer precision are small adjustments that can improve performance. Additionally, turn off the power-saving mode for USB ports. These tweaks can reduce the impact of software conflicts on your device.

Run System Maintenance Tools

Utilise built-in operating system tools, such as the Hardware Troubleshooter available in Windows. Regular scans for malware and viruses are also helpful, as these can interfere with your mouse’s performance.

Advanced Techniques for Resolving Persistent Freezing Issues

Test with a Different Mouse

If problems continue, try switching to another wireless or USB mouse. This will help determine whether the issue lies with the device itself or with your system’s connectivity setup.

An outdated operating system can sometimes be the root of mouse performance problems. Make sure your OS is updated, or consider rolling back any recent updates if issues started afterwards.

Reset Mouse Settings

Resetting your mouse configurations to their default settings is often a straightforward fix. This step can clear any custom settings that may be interfering with optimal performance.

Expert Tip: Minimise Signal Interference for Smooth Mouse Performance

Did you know that placing your wireless mouse receiver within 12 inches of your mouse can drastically reduce signal interference? Avoid metal desks and crowded USB hubs to ensure uninterrupted connectivity.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why does my wireless mouse keep freezing?

Wireless mouse freezing can occur due to signal interference, low battery, outdated drivers, or software conflicts. Use the checklist above to tackle each possibility effectively.

How to fix a wireless mouse that stops randomly?

Start by checking that your USB receiver is securely connected, then inspect the battery and update your drivers. If the issue persists, try resetting the mouse settings or testing a different mouse.

How to fix a glitchy wireless mouse?

Reduce signal interference, disable pointer trails, and ensure your drivers are current. Additionally, running a malware scan and checking your operating system for updates may help resolve persistent issues.

Why does my wireless mouse work intermittently?

Intermittent connectivity is often caused by battery issues, signal interference, or a weak connection between the mouse and its receiver. Regular maintenance and a quick check using our troubleshooting steps should restore reliable performance.
